A while back, some of you may remember this post (Oh what was I thinking with the Plath comment...)
Well, that being said, that post was about the character of Naoko Akagi, mother to scientist Ritsuko Akagi, one of the (sorta) main characters on Evangelion. Ritsuko's case is an interesting one, she's sort of a main character, and she sort of isn't. Obviously the five main characters would be Shinji, Asuka, Rei, Misato, and Kaworu, and then we have Ritsuko and Gendo. (and now meganeko Mari in the Rebuild franchise)
In 1996, after Evangelion ended, Hideaki Anno started to receive death threats from fans due to the unexpected finale that was episode 25/26. Anno was only able to complete it using the budget they had, and it wasn't helped that a few GAINAX employees were found to be embezzling money...still, Anno created the full length feature film End of Evangelion in 1997. While the final two episodes reflected what went on in the characters subconscious, EoE reflected what went on in the physical world. The film was a success, although shocked many, and the manga version of it I'm afraid, isn't much of a happy stroll through merry land either. This post will focus on Ritsuko Akagi, and her downfall and eventual (you guessed it) death.
